The answer should be 95in^2

Step-by-step explanation:

You’re essentially just finding the area of all the shapes on the triangle and adding them together.

Area of a triangle = 1/2•b•h
Area of a square = l•w or just s2

The area of the triangles given what we have in the diagram can be found with
1/2•5•7 = 17.5

There are 4 triangles so you multiply 17.5 by 4 which gives 70

The base of the triangle (the square) = 25

70+25=95
